A Few Things to Know Before You Apply:
This is a casual position, not a full-time role. Most bookings are last-minute and based on availability, usually when I, or my wonderful sitter Rylee are unable to take on a job ourselves. That means flexibility is super important. Although this job is very rewarding it can also be quite demanding, so please keep this in mind before applying.
You must be 18 years or older
You’ll need a valid driver’s licence
You must be willing to get your Canine First Aid certificate:

Job Requirements:
This role involves the following duties:
Walking dogs for 30 minutes - 1 hour at a time
Lifting up to 25 kg (dog food, dog butts (hehe) pet accessories, etc.)
Being outdoors in varying weather conditions (sun, rain, etc.)
Handling dogs of different breeds and energy levels
Feeding, administering medications.
It’s totally okay if you have another job! Just keep in mind that for any sits you accept, you’ll need to:
Walk the dogs in the morning and afternoon
Send regular photo updates to me or directly to our clients
